Mr. Speaker, this timely resolution draws our attention to the 50th anniversary of the Marshall plan which will be celebrated on June 5. It reminds us of the grand commitment made by Secretary of State George Marshall and President Harry Truman, supported by a farsighted bipartisan group of Congressmen and Senators. It was this commitment that made possible the economic prosperity which we have now come to take for granted in Western Europe and allowed democratic institutions to develop and thrive. Most importantly, it allowed the peoples of Western Europe, who are now our closest allies, to emerge from the ashes of the Second World War and to rebuild their lives anew. As we reflect back on those troubled and uncertain times that followed the end of World War II, we should renew the commitment to the principles that underlaid our actions at that time, and remember that there remain people in Central and Eastern Europe as well as the former Soviet Union who were prevented from benefiting from the Marshall plan, and who now look to us to do for them what was done for the Europeans some 50 years ago.
